The United States with 4.

1) 1904 in St. Louis

2) 1932 in Los Angeles

3) 1984 in Los Angeles

4) 1996 in Atlanta

Why are the Olympic games called modern summer Olympic Games?

The word "modern" distinguishes the games since 1896 from the ancient Greek Olympic games from 776 BC. There are two Olympics games, summer and winter, referring to the season of year the games are held in and the sports contested therein.
